Marine expansion will create 75 new jobs in Lee County

3 min read

The Lee County Office of Economic Development announced today that the County and State have approved financial incentives for J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ts to support its headquarter expansion plans in Fort Myers, Florida. The incentives will assist the company in creating 75 new jobs in Lee County. The economic impact in the county for this project is estimated at $6.3 million.

The Company has expanded at the current facility many times in the past. Now with the growth into new markets under the JRL Ventures business name, they again need to grow the business. They currently have a small facility in Sarasota and considered this area, as well as, other parts of Florida (i.e. Charlotte County), Georgia, North Carolina and Tennessee.

The company currently employs 40 full-time employees, their growth plan and new business is expected to create at least 75 new jobs over the next three years at an average Lee County wage of $41,650 which is 115 percent of the average wage.

As part of the expansion, J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ts will receive a Qualified Tax Incentive (QTI) from the State of Florida and Lee County worth $225,000. Of the $225,000 in QTI incentives $180,000 or 80 percent comes from the State and the remaining 20 percent, or $45,000 match comes from the Lee County incentive program.

“We are excited about the expansion of J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ts in Lee County,” said Jim Moore, Executive Director of the Lee County Office of Economic Development. “I wish them much continued success as the result of their expansion in Lee County, and thank all of those that have helped create a business climate in Southwest Florida that nourishes the growth of innovative companies like J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ts.”

We are encouraged by the positive business atmosphere in Lee County,” said Matt Chambers, President of J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ts “and we’ve decided that it will be a great base for our expanding company. Thank you to the Lee County Economic Development Office, the Governor’s Office and Enterprise Florida for helping to make our expansion in Southwest Florida region possible.”

About J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ts

Founded in Cape Coral in 1975 and purchased by the current owner in 1993. JRL Ventures, Inc./Marine Concepts is the premier supplier, design and engineer of plugs, patterns and molds for many different types of composite industries. They have extensive experience in the marine industry. Their past and new growth has allowed them to expand into the following market segments: composite part manufacturers, RV industry, parks, attractions & icons, simulators, aerospace and renewable energy.

JRL Ventures Inc has completed two renewable energy projects to date. The first being a water turbine project, the second project was a 1KW wind turbine. As of this press release, JRL Ventures has now started their third renewable energy project. The new projects just awarded to them from one of the world’s largest wind energy component manufacturers.

About the Lee County Office of Economic Development:

The Economic Development Office of Lee County in Southwest Florida works to attract new and diversified businesses resulting in high-wage, high-skilled jobs; retains and encourages the expansion of existing businesses and improves the overall business environment in Lee County. Lee County is a thriving business community with a highly regarded airport, significant corporate development and ample real estate opportunities. The area is attracting, retaining and growing high-value businesses with a unique blend of an outstanding business climate and superior quality of life. The county is home to five vibrant cities-Cape Coral, Fort Myers, Bonita Springs, Fort Myers Beach, and Sanibel-and is the heart of Southwest Florida.
